zoukankan      html  css  js  c++  java
  • Linux常用命令及操作

    shutdown -r now现在重启
    shutdown -h now现在关机
    reboot重启
    startx进入图形界面
    chmod +x 777 文件名 授权和可执行 777为二进制111-111-111(系统用户-当前用户-其他用户)
    ls -a -s -color显示所有文件(a显示所有,s显示大小,color不同文件不同颜色)
    root:存储root用户的相关文件
    home:普通用的相关文件
    bin:存放常用命令的文件(相当于windows的system32)
    sbin:要具有一定权限才可以使用的命令
    mnt:默认用来挂载光驱和软驱的目录
    boot:用来存放引导的文件
    etc:用来存放配置相关的文件目录
    var:存放经常变化的数据(相当于temp?)
    usr:安装软件的默认路径
    最基本的用户管理
    useradd xiaoming
    passwd xiaoming
    userdel xiaoming
    红帽子系统运行级别(ubuntu有点不同)
    命令:init[0123456]
    常用运行级别
        0关机    所以用sudo init 0可以关机
        3多用户状态有网络服务
        5图形界面
        6重启
    /etc/inittab的id:5:initdefault中的数字
    修改运行级别:在进入的时候按e,然后选中第二个按e,然后输入1回车,然后按
    |:管道命令(把上一个命令的结果交给后面的命令处理)
    more:分页命令
    grep:查找文件中的关键字 例如:grep - n "ScvQ" a.txt查看a.txt中的ScvQ并指明行数
    man相当于help命令
    find / -name a.txt查找根目录(即全部文件)下a.txt文件
    ls -l >a.txt将显示的结果输入到a.txt中
    主分区+扩展分区<=4,扩展分区不能直接用,必须再分成一个或多个逻辑分区才能使用
    fdisk -l查看磁盘
    df 查看分区(有用)  df 目录名  查看目录挂载在哪个分区
    安装系统必须要配置的3个
    /    根分区
    /boot    引导分区
    swap    交换分区
    ls -l /bin/*sh    显示有多少种shell
    1、查看目前使用的是哪种shell,env 显示当前系统的环境变量
    2、chsh -s /bin/csh把shell改成csh(有3种shell)
    3、更改需要重新登陆
    tab具有补全功能,双击tab具有提示功能
    history命令显示历史输入的命令
    linux下的网络配置
    1、root下setup命令,进行配置
    2、这是网卡的配置还没有生效,用/etc/rc.d/init.d/network restart命令使设置生效
    
    以下都是临时的,重启无效(ubuntu下vim /etc/resolv.conf)
    ifconfig 网卡(eth0) IP地址    设置IP地址
    ifconfig 网卡(eth0) network 地址   设置子网掩码
    gedit resolv.conf(sername 8.8.8.8)   设置DNS   
    
    1、修改/etc/sysconfig/network-scripts/ifcfg-eth0里的各个属性(ubuntu下vim /etc/network/interfaces)
    2、/etc/rc.d/init.d/network restart使上面的生效
    
    虚拟机的NAT模式:虚拟机的ip和宿主机的虚拟网卡在一个网段里,且宿主机作为虚拟机的网关,即虚拟机通过宿主机上网
    虚拟机的网桥:网桥与交换机类似,虚拟机的ip和宿主机的物理网卡在同一个网段里,物理网卡相当与桥接器
    调度命令
    1、crontab -e
    2、* * * * * date>>/home/mydate(每分钟将时间放到mydate中)
    
    调度多个任务
    1、在crontab -e加入多个
    2、可以把所有的任务写到一个可执行的文件(shell编程),建一个.sh的脚本,然后在crontab -e执行这个脚本
    进程
    ps -aux | more
    ps -e
    top动态的显示
    kill pid
    kill -9 pid杀无赦
    cal 2016 查看2016年的日历
    netstat -an显示整个系统目前的网络情况(netstat -anp->kill pid)
    ping ....
  • 相关阅读:
    Vue使用QrCode插件生成二维码
    简述Vue的路由与视图
    EntityFrameworkCore将数据库Timestamp类型在程序中转为long类型
    Linux常用命令——软件包管理
    Linux常用命令——文本编辑器Vim
    Linux常用命令——关机重启命令
    Linux常用命令——网络命令
    Linux常用命令——压缩解压命令
    Linux常用命令——文件搜索命令
    .NET Core 配置GC工作模式与内存的影响
  • 原文地址:https://www.cnblogs.com/ScvQ/p/6871774.html
Copyright © 2011-2022 走看看